In today’s article we will show you how to make a balloon sculpture with this easy step by step guide.
Balloon Sculptures are air-filled so they sit either on the floor or on a sideboard. Air-filled designs will last for much longer than helium balloons, they will last you for weeks!

Materials needed
For this type of Balloon Sculpture you will need:
-12 x Large 11โ Balloons
-6 x Mini 5โ Balloons
-1 x Giant Foil Number Balloon
-Roll of Glue Dots
-Ribbon
-Handle Pump or an electrical pump (faster)
- Optional : 3 Small Foil Balloons or Paper Cuts
Tips & Tricks
-It is advisable to inflate the balloons a little bit less than the actual maximum size of the balloon. E.g a 11โ balloon to inflate about 9-10โ and a 5โ balloon to about 4โ. Reason being that the balloons burst much more easily if they are too inflated.
-It is no problem to prepare the balloon sculpture the evening before it is actually needed.
-Make sure that the floor you are preparing the balloon sculpture on is clean. Otherwise you might end up with dust sticking to your balloons.
-You might have noticed that in the instructions there are very often the words โtightlyโ or โas tight as possibleโ. This is for a reason. Should your balloon sculpture be unstable, this is most likely because it has not been tied as tightly as it should be. If this is the case, simply unwrap the ribbon and put the sculpture together again. If the foil number balloon is still unsteady, use some of the additional glue dots to stabilise it.
-Balloons do not do too well in direct (strong) sun light. They might change their colour slightly and /or might burst.
1. Blowing up the Balloons
Let’s start with blowing up the balloons. Since you will need to blow up quite a few balloons, you may need a hand held balloon pump. Alternatively, you can invest in an electric balloon pump to get faster results.
Inflate 12 of the 11 inch balloons to equal size of about 9-10โ.
To achieve the best results inflating your balloons you can read our tutorial about Blowing up Party Balloons [ Hints & Tips ]
2. Making the Base of the Sculpture
Link two balloons by tying them together at their knots. ( Do not worry to pull on them gently. As long as you do not over-inflate the balloons, they will not burst easily.)
Take two pairs of balloons and intertwine them to create a single group of four balloons. Do so by placing one pair of balloons on top of the other pair and squeeze the top balloons between the bottom balloons. Twist two adjoining balloons so that they change position.
Tip:
- Take one spare 11โ inch balloon and fill it with water so it is about the size of your palm. Close it with a knot and tie the ribbon to it. ( The water balloon is needed to add weight to the column.)
- Tie the water balloon tightly to the first 11โ balloon group by wrapping the ribbon around the middle of the cluster of balloons.
- Turn the balloons the other way around so that the water balloon is at the bottom of the structure.
3. Assemble all the parts together
Place the second balloon group on top of the first balloon group. Wrap the ribbon numerous times around the middle of the balloon cluster. It is important that while doing so to press down the middle of the balloons in order for the balloons to be tightly connected to the balloon group underneath. Repeat this step with the final balloon cluster and cut the remaining ribbon.
4. Add the Foil Number Balloon
Inflate the number balloon and tie the remaining ribbon to it.
Tie the number balloon tightly to the top of the latex balloon cluster. If tied tightly it should stand upright.
Inflate the foil balloons ( if included ) with the balloon pump or the help of a straw. Inflate the 5โ mini latex balloons.
To attach the 5โmini latex balloons, the foil balloons or cutouts to the sculpture, you will need to use the glue dots provided. Cut off one glue dot from the strip. Stick it to the balloon and then peel the paper off.
